I am new course creator here. I want to promote my course and I want to know how to get first 100 students.

Good for you for getting your course out there! I can't say if what worked for me will work for you, but here are my top tips:

 

 

1. Pay careful attention to your landing page. The title needs to both contain the keywords and suggest the benefit of doing your course.

2. Your promo video is very important.  Describe benefits over features and connect on both an emotional and intellectual level.

3. Tell students why your course is different to other courses.

4. Ask for reviews. Obviously don't ask for 5 star reviews!

5. If you have a YouTube channel, post a sample video.

 

 

There are some things NOT to do.

 

1. Don't post free coupons all over Facebook. Very bad idea as these students don't take the course and sometimes free students leave bad reviews.

2. Most instructors concurr Facebook advertising doesn't work.

3. Don't get friends and family to leave reviews. They will be filtered out.
